WebCU is one of the best colleges for Aerospace. We're the #1 NASA funded public college, and the only college on Earth to have been part of satellite projects that have visited all of the planets, including pluto. The courses are difficult but the professors definitely know what they're talking about. Freeze95 • 6 yr. ago WebCU Boulder is an excellent institution at which to study physics. CU has cutting edge researchers, particularly in aerospace and planetary physics. CU also has excellent labs and facilities (at one time CU flew and monitored its own satellite).
